Rivaroxaban, Aspirin, or Both to Prevent Early Coronary Bypass Graft Occlusion: The COMPASS-CABG Study.
Patients with recent coronary artery bypass graft (CABG) surgery are at risk for early graft failure, which is associated with a risk of myocardial infarction and death. In the COMPASS (Cardiovascular OutcoMes for People Using Anticoagulation StrategieS) trial, rivaroxaban 2.5 mg twice daily plus aspirin 100 mg once daily compared with aspirin 100 mg once daily reduced the primary major adverse cardiovascular events (MACE) outcome of cardiovascular death, stroke, or myocardial infarction. Rivaroxaban 5 mg twice daily alone did not significantly reduce MACE.. This pre-planned substudy sought to determine whether the COMPASS treatments are more effective than aspirin alone for preventing graft failure and MACE after CABG surgery.. The substudy randomized 1,448 COMPASS trial patients 4 to 14 days after CABG surgery to receive the combination of rivaroxaban plus aspirin, rivaroxaban alone, or aspirin alone. The primary outcome was graft failure, diagnosed by computed tomography angiogram 1 year after surgery.. The combination of rivaroxaban and aspirin and the regimen of rivaroxaban alone did not reduce the graft failure rates compared with aspirin alone (combination vs. aspirin: 113 [9.1%] vs. 91 [8.0%] failed grafts; odds ratio [OR]: 1.13; 95% confidence interval [CI]: 0.82 to 1.57; p = 0.45; rivaroxaban alone vs. aspirin: 92 [7.8%] vs. 92 [8.0%] failed grafts; OR: 0.95; 95% CI: 0.67 to 1.33; p = 0.75). Compared with aspirin, the combination was associated with fewer MACE (12 [2.4%] vs. 16 [3.5%]; hazard ratio [HR]: 0.69; 95% CI: 0.33 to 1.47; p = 0.34), whereas rivaroxaban alone was not (16 [3.3%] vs. 16 [3.5%]; HR: 0.99, CI: 0.50 to 1.99; p = 0.98). There was no fatal bleeding or tamponade within 30 days of randomization.. The combination of rivaroxaban 2.5 mg twice daily plus aspirin or rivaroxaban 5 mg twice daily alone compared with aspirin alone did not reduce graft failure in patients with recent CABG surgery, but the combination of rivaroxaban 2.5 mg twice daily plus aspirin was associated with similar reductions in MACE, as observed in the larger COMPASS trial. (Cardiovascular OutcoMes for People Using Anticoagulation StrategieS [COMPASS]; NCT01776424). Effect of Rivaroxaban and Clopidogrel Combination Therapy on In-Stent Responses After Everolimus-Eluting Stent Implantation in a Porcine Coronary Model.
According to recent clinical trials, a combination of direct oral anticoagulants with antiplatelet drugs is often recommended for atrial fibrillation patients who receive drug-eluting stents (DESs). Pigs were given either aspirin and clopidogrel (dual antiplatelet therapy [DAPT] group), aspirin and rivaroxaban (AR group), or clopidogrel and rivaroxaban (CR group), followed by everolimus-eluting stent (Promus Element) implantation into the coronary artery. Stented coronary arteries were evaluated via intravascular optical coherence tomography (OCT) and histological analysis at 1 and 3 months.. OCT revealed lower neointimal thickness in the DAPT group and comparable thickness among all groups at 1 and 3 months, respectively. Histological analyses revealed comparable neointimal area among all groups and the smallest neointimal area in the CR group at 1 and 3 months, respectively. In the DAPT and AR groups, the neointima continued to grow from 1 to 3 months. A shortened time course for neointima growth was observed in the CR group, with rapid growth within a month (maintained for 3 months). A higher incidence of in-stent thrombi was observed in the AR group at 1 month; no thrombi were found in either group at 3 months. More smooth muscle cells with contractile features were found in the CR group at both 1 and 3 months.. Our results proved the noninferiority of the combination of rivaroxaban with an antiplatelet drug, particularly the dual therapy using rivaroxaban and clopidogrel, compared to DAPT after DES implantation.
